Android Wear
Daniel Nogueira - [email protected] Pereira - [email protected]
O que é o CodeLab de Android Wear?
É um evento para um grupo de pessoas interessadas no Android Wear.
Construiremos juntos sua primeira aplicação para o relógio Android Wear.
Para participar você deve conhecer o básico de Android e Java e levar seu Notebook com o ambiente previamente configurado conforme estes requisitos.
Se você já cumpriu todos os passos de configuração de ambiente, por favor se inscreva neste formulário.
Agenda
● Android Wear;● Configuração do Ambiente;● Emulador;● Dicas;● Código fonte
o Simple Notification; Networking (Coffee)
o Wear App;o Google Samples;o Outros.
Android Wear
Compatível com Android 4.3 ou posterior. Notificações em contextos diferentes:
Bicicleta, Ônibus, Café da manhã, Aula, etc
Por onde começo?
Material do Googledeveloper.android.com/training/building-wearables.html
App Android Wearplay.google.com/store/apps/details?id=com.google.android.wearable.app
Configuração do ambiente
Configuração do ambiente
Requisitos:-Java JDK 8;
-Ferramenta para desenvolvimentoAndroid Studio
-Pacotes do Android SDK Manager
Emulador AVD Manager
Emulador AVD Manager
Android Virtual Device Manager
1. Create New2. Start
Configuração do ambiente
Para conectar o Emulador do Android Wear com o seu Smartphone
No WindowsAbra o Prompt de Comandoscd ~android\sdk\platform-tools
No Mac ou LinuxAbra o Terminal
adb -d forward tcp:5601 tcp:5601
Taca-le Pau
www.vogella.com/tutorials/AndroidNotifications/
article.html
Código Notificação Android Simples
+ Notifications
http://developer.android.com/design/patterns/notifications.html
https://www.youtube.com/watch?v=EHTU5CxhoZ4
+ Notifications
github.com/googlesamples/android-LNotifications
Automação de Build
gradle.orgdeveloper.android.com/sdk/installing/studio-build.html
gradleplease.appspot.com
Exemplo que mostra como fazer uma App para o Wear-1 Finish-2 Chamar outra tela
github.com/gdgmanaus/DevFestWear
Código Exemplo App Wear
Lista no Wearable
https://developer.android.com/training/wearables/
ui/lists.html
Avançado
Wear Data Sync
Exemplo dehttp://www.doubleencore.com/2014/07/create-custom-ongoing-notification-android-wear/
https://github.com/gdgmanaus/WearSyncData
O que devemos repetir?O que pode mudar?
GDG nós podemos ajudar também?
Feedbacks